We are a group of artistic women with diverse backgrounds and a common passion for the empowerment of women through the expression of sensual movement. We have come together to create a stage play, POLE PLAY: TAKING FLIGHT, that uses dialogue scenes, pole dancing, sensual movement and music to tell the story of a woman's lifelong struggle to take ownership of her own sexuality. Pole Tip of the Day --The short shorts and small tops of our dancers were not worn because of the heat! It's because fabric slides right off a pole while bare skin sticks better. That is why pole dancers' outfits tend to be a bit....uh...."skimpy!"
